Court stops EFCC, ICPC and DSS from detaining former Governor Yari

The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, the Independent Corrupt Practices and other related offences Commission, the Department of State Services and other security agencies have been restrained by a federal high court sitting in Abuja from detaining a former governor of Zamfara State and Senator-elect, Abdul’aziz Yari, pending the hearing and determination of the motion on notice.

Justice Donatus Okorowo gave the order in a ruling he delivered on an ex-parte motion on Monday, June 5. The respondents (EFCC, ICPC and DSS) were directed by the Judge to show cause in the next adjourned date on why the prayers sought on the motion ex-parte should not be granted.

Okorowo said;

“The respondents were, however, restrained from detaining the applicant until the return date for the order to show cause.”

The judge adjourned the matter to June 8 for the respondents to show cause.
